Who Plays Oliver Twist?
The role of Oliver Twist, the young orphan at the heart of the story, is typically cast with a young actor possessing a strong singing voice and the ability to portray vulnerability and resilience. The ideal Oliver is not just a good singer; he needs to connect emotionally with the audience, conveying both his innocence and his growing strength. Many productions choose to cast multiple actors to play Oliver, rotating them throughout the run to manage the demands of the role.
What Other Major Roles are in Oliver!?
Beyond Oliver, "Oliver!" features a rich tapestry of characters, each with their own distinct personality and motivations. Some of the most significant roles include:
-
Fagin: The manipulative and cunning leader of a gang of young pickpockets. Fagin requires a charismatic actor with strong comedic timing and the ability to portray both menace and a surprising vulnerability.
-
Nancy: A member of Fagin's gang who shows surprising compassion towards Oliver. This role demands a powerful vocalist and a compelling actress capable of expressing both strength and vulnerability. Nancy’s iconic song, "As Long As He Needs Me," is a cornerstone of the production.
-
Bill Sikes: Nancy's abusive boyfriend and a brutal criminal. This character requires an actor who can convey a sense of menace and brutality, while also hinting at a tragic backstory.
-
Mr. Bumble: The pompous and self-important beadle, often cast as a comedic character with a strong baritone voice.
-
Mrs. Corney: The matron of the workhouse, often played as a character with sharp wit and a no-nonsense attitude.
-
Mr. Brownlow: The kind and benevolent gentleman who takes Oliver under his wing. This role usually requires an actor with a refined and authoritative presence.
How Many Actors are in Oliver!?
The size of the cast for "Oliver!" can vary depending on the production. Larger-scale productions may have a cast of several dozen actors, while smaller-scale productions might have a more streamlined cast. The number of actors required is also influenced by the decision to use child actors or adult actors to play younger roles. The chorus is crucial, representing various street urchins and townspeople.

H2: What are the ages of the actors playing Oliver?
The age of the actor playing Oliver can vary slightly depending on the production, but they are typically cast as children, usually between the ages of 8 and 14. Many productions use multiple young actors to share the role and manage the demanding performance schedule.
H2: Are there different versions of Oliver!?
Yes, there have been several different adaptations and productions of "Oliver!" over the years, resulting in some variations in the script, music, and even casting choices. These differences are usually minor, however, and the core storyline remains consistent.
